node_modules/ 如果你想检查node_modules中的某些特定文件或文件夹,可以在.eslintignore文件中排除它们。例如,如果你想检查node_modules/some-library文件夹,可以这样配置: 代码语言:javascript 复制 node_modules/* !node_modules/some-library/ 这将忽略node_modules下的所有文件,但包含some-library文件夹。
我怎么能忽略 node_modules 文件夹?我正在使用的软件包版本: "eslint": "^5.16.0", "babel-eslint": "^9.0.0", "eslint-config-airbnb": "^16.1.0", "eslint-import-resolver-babel-module": "^5.1.2", "eslint-loader": "1.9.0", "eslint-plugin-flowtype": "2.39.1", "eslint-plugin...
在使用 ESLint 进行代码质量检查时,如果你希望排除某些文件夹不进行检查,可以按照以下步骤进行操作: 1. 确定需要排除的文件夹路径 首先,明确你想要 ESLint 忽略的文件夹路径。例如,你可能想要忽略 node_modules 文件夹和 dist 文件夹。 2. 在 ESLint 配置文件中找到 ignorePatterns 字段 ESLint 的配置文件通常是 ...
下载压缩包,存放在~/.npm(本地NPM缓存路径)目录 解压压缩包到当前项目的node_modules目录 实际上说一个模块安装以后,本地其实保存了两份。一份是 ~/.npm 目录下的压缩包,另一份是 node_modules 目录下解压后的代码。但是,运行 npm install 的时候,只会检查 node_modules 目录,而不会检查 ~/.npm 目录。如...
// 指定检查的目录,或者配置排除某些文件夹 // include: [path.resolve(__dirname, 'src')], // 注意:只检查自己写的源代码,第三方的库是不用检查的,这里排除node_modules文件夹 exclude:/node_modules/, loader:'eslint-loader', /* 1. pre 优先处理 ...
即便是主动添加忽略也无效 考虑更新依赖的版本也没用 最疯狂的是就连把eslint都删掉了,还是报警告 解决办法 最后没办法把node_modules 和 package-lock.json 都删掉重新安装后,问题竟然消失了?! 可能原因 猜测可能是使用了npm audit fix --force造成的
"**/node_modules/**" // 排除所有node_modules文件夹及其子文件夹下的文件 ], "rules": { // 其他规则配置... } } 通过以上配置,ESLint将会忽略指定的文件或文件夹进行代码检查,从而达到排除特定文件的目的。这对于排除一些自动生成的文件、第三方库文件、构建产物等是非常有用的。
"**/node_modules": true, "**/build": true, "**/dist": true, "**/.git": true, "**/.vscode": true } } 1. 2. 3. 4. 5. 6. 7. 8. 9. 上面的示例中,我们配置了五个排除规则: "**/node_modules": true- 这将排除项目中的node_modules文件夹,通常包含依赖库。
下面的配置是通过 运行vue inspect来查看 eslint-loader的配置,正常是只检测 src 的业务代码 ,排除 node_modules目录,从而提高了编译打包速度 {enforce:'pre',test:/\.(vue|(j|t)sx?)$/,exclude:[/node_modules/,'/Users/***/Documents/WDH_library/myProject/my-vue-lib/node_modules/@vue/cli-service...
例如,可以通过`.eslintignore`文件排除掉node_modules等第三方库目录,只专注于检查项目源码。其次,利用缓存机制加速检查过程。eslint支持缓存功能,通过在命令行中添加`--cache`选项,可以让eslint记住之前已检查过的文件状态,从而在下次运行时跳过这些文件,显著提升效率。最后,适时更新插件版本,获取最新的性能改进与bug...